As of August 2026, the average salary for Microelectronics Engineer at Dmdc in the United States is $110,958 per year, which is equivalent to an hourly rate of approximately $53. Most salaries for this position fall within the range of $99,434 to $121,429 annually.
DISCLAIMER: The salary range presented here is an estimation that has been derived from our proprietary algorithm. It should be noted that this range does not originate from the company's factual payroll records or survey data.
